In reply to your message about ED in Spain. We went to IM in Barcelona. It took two attempts but we now have a beautiful baby boy.
The clinic looked after us very well. They were professional and supportive. IM is expensive compared to other clinics (around £7000 per cycle) but we were very happy with our treatment. We chose IM partly on recommendation by my GP and partly because of the short flying time.
If you contact them direct , by email , they will answer any of your questions. An English Doctor is available to contact, so there are no language problems. There are no waiting lists for ED treatment.

I can't recommend IM highly enough. I'm 43 years old and after 2 failed IVF cycles here in the UK we were pretty despondent until I found the IM on the internet. We have made several visits to the clinic and the standard of care is fantastic: they are really focused on success. I am waiting to take my first blood test tomorrow and (after 2 embryos transferred 2 weeks ago). Regardless of whether or not this round was successful I have no hesitation in recommending IM to you. We wish we had found them sooner and saved ourselves the grief of IVF with my aged eggs. Unfortunately, the NHS clinic we went to were EXTREMELY reluctant to discuss any overseas clinics and would not name any.
We've dealt mainly with 2 doctors and the IM - one of them English and the other Spanish. Both spoke at least two languages and the receptionist spoke at least 3! So, communication is not a problem at all. And you know what??? No waiting lists.
